Walmart Central Fill Pharmacy is a specialized type of pharmacy that focuses on processing and dispensing of prescriptions for multiple retail pharmacy locations within a region. Unlike a traditional pharmacy, Central Fill is full of automation allowing prescriptions to be filled fast and accurately, but the best part of Central Fill pharmacy is taking care of our patients in the community. While we are not patient facing, our job provides retail pharmacies the ability to spend much deserved time providing clinical services and education to the communities they serve.
